Abstract :
Trellis dirty paper watermarking is an implement of watermarking with side information, which has very good performances. But the structure issue remains unclear, and how to choose a proper structure and reference pattern in terms of all the performance indexes is still a problem. In this paper, the performance indexes of the trellis dirty paper watermarking and its factors that affect the performances are introduced, and the effect of trellis structure and reference pattern on fidelity, robustness and complexity are tested and analyzed. Experimental results provide a better understanding of the trellis dirty paper watermarking, it shows that different trellis structure and reference pattern have great effect on the performances, but in most situations, the 64 times 64 trellis can get a better tradeoff among fidelity, robustness and complexity. Besides, choosing the reference pattern which has the more similar distribution with the cover work can get a lower bit error ratio.
